What is Xenical and its Generic Equivalent?

Xenical is the brand name for the active ingredient Orlistat. It comes from a class of drugs known as lipase inhibitors. Unlike many other weight reduction medications that act on the main nervous system to reduce hunger, Orlistat works locally within the gastrointestinal system.

In Germany, as soon as the patent for the initial maker (Roche) ended, other pharmaceutical business were allowed to produce generic variations. These generic versions are sold under the name "Orlistat" followed by the manufacturer's name (e.g., Orlistat HEXAL, Orlistat ratiopharm, or Orlistat STADA).

How Orlistat Works

The primary function of generic Xenical is to prevent the absorption of fat from the diet. It targets enzymes called gastric and pancreatic lipases. These enzymes are responsible for breaking down triglycerides (fats) into smaller sized particles that the body can take in. When Orlistat is present:

  1. It binds to the lipase enzymes.
  2. It prevents the enzymes from breaking down about 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al.
  3. The undigested fat passes through the gastrointestinal system and is gotten rid of by means of defecation.

Germany has strict guidelines relating to pharmaceutical distribution. The schedule of Orlistat depends completely on the dose strength.

The 120mg Dosage (Prescription Required)

Generic Xenical at the standard therapeutic dose of 120mg is classified as Rezeptpflichtig (prescription-only). A patient needs to seek advice from a health care company to figure out if they fulfill the requirements for treatment. Typically, a prescription is given if:

  • The client has a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or higher.
  • The client has a BMI of 28 or greater, accompanied by weight-related threat factors (e.g., Type 2 diabetes, hypertension, or high cholesterol).

The 60mg Dosage (Over-the-Counter)

Lower-dose variations of Orlistat (60mg) are readily available Rezeptfrei (over-the-counter) in German pharmacies (Apotheken). These are typically marketed toward people with a BMI of 28 or higher who wish to manage their weight without an official prescription. While available without a medical professional's note, it is still recommended to seek advice from a pharmacist before beginning the program.

Practical Application: Diet and Lifestyle Integration

Generic Xenical is not a "magic pill." Its effectiveness is strictly reliant on the patient's diet plan. Due to the fact that the medication prevents fat absorption, the existence of too much fat in the intestinal tracts can result in unpleasant gastrointestinal adverse effects.

Dietary Guidelines

To make the most of results and minimize discomfort, patients ought to follow these dietary actions:

  1. Low-Fat Distribution: Daily fat consumption should be limited to around 30% of overall calories.
  2. Meal Balance: Fat consumption must be spread equally over 3 primary meals. If a meal is avoided or includes no fat, the dose of Orlistat must be left out.
  3. Calorie Deficit: A mildly hypocaloric diet plan is essential for real weight loss to occur.
  4. Vitamin Supplementation: Because Orlistat can hinder the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K), it is frequently advised to take a multivitamin at bedtime.

Actions to Starting the Treatment

  • Assessment: See a physician to check for contraindications such as persistent malabsorption syndrome or cholestasis.
  • Standard Measurements: Record starting weight, BMI, and waist area.
  • Drug store Purchase: Purchase the generic variation from a regional or licensed online drug store in Germany.
  • Tracking: Track progress and negative effects over the first 3 months. Standard practice includes stopping the drug if 5% of body weight has actually not been lost within 12 weeks.

Possible Side Effects

While generic Xenical is typically thought about safe, the way it connects with dietary fat methods that negative effects are typical, particularly in the initial weeks.

Common Side Effects (Gastrointestinal):

  • Oily identifying in underwears.
  • Flatulence with discharge.
  • Oily or fatty stools (Steatorrhea).
  • Increased frequency of bowel motions.
  • Urgent requirement to go to the bathroom.

These adverse effects are often described as "treatment effects" since they work as a feedback mechanism, motivating the client to strictly restrict their fat consumption.

1. Is generic Xenical covered by German health insurance?

In many cases, no. Weight loss medications are generally categorized as "lifestyle drugs" in Germany and are left out from compensation by statutory health insurance (GKV). Patients typically pay out-of-pocket using a "Privatrezept."

3. The length of time can I take generic Xenical?

The medication is usually approved for long-lasting use (as much as a couple of years) as long as the client continues to slim down and does not experience extreme negative effects. Routine medical check-ups are needed for long-term therapy.

5. Are there any medications that interact with Orlistat?

Orlistat can reduce the absorption of particular medications, such as Cyclosporine, Levothyroxine (thyroid medicine), and some anti-epileptic drugs. It may also affect the absorption of contraceptive pills if severe diarrhea takes place. Constantly notify your medical professional of all present medications.
